Tooth Removal Treatment
If you require a tooth removal, you can expect an experienced oral cosmetic surgeon to very carefully and skillfully eliminate your tooth making use of specialized instruments and strategies.
Initially, the dental doctor will administer an anesthetic to numb the area around the tooth. This makes certain that you will not really feel any kind of pain during the procedure.
Next off, the cosmetic surgeon will utilize a device called an elevator to loosen the tooth from its outlet. Dental Implant Surgery
During oral implant surgical treatment, a dental cosmetic surgeon will carefully place a titanium implant right into your jawbone to function as a replacement for a missing out on tooth. This treatment is commonly performed under regional anesthetic to ensure your convenience throughout the procedure.

In time, the dental implant fuses with the bone through a procedure called osseointegration, giving a steady foundation for the substitute tooth.
After the surgery, you may experience some discomfort and swelling, but this can be handled with pain medicine and ice bag. It is necessary to follow your dental surgeon's post-operative guidelines to promote proper recovery and ensure the success of the implant.
Wisdom Teeth Removal
When it concerns wisdom teeth removal, you can anticipate the oral surgeon to carefully draw out these 3rd molars to prevent any kind of possible oral concerns. Wisdom teeth, also referred to as 3rd molars, normally emerge in between the ages of 17 and 25. Nevertheless, they frequently trigger troubles because of lack of area in the mouth.
Here are a few key points to think about:
- A dental doctor will administer regional anesthetic to numb the area and ensure a painless treatment.
- The doctor will certainly make a cut in the periodontal cells to access the impacted tooth.
- In some cases, the tooth may require to be divided right into areas for easier removal.
- After the extraction, you might experience some swelling, bleeding, and pain, which can be handled with discomfort medicine and ice bag.
